Friendly Skies

ºÚÁÏÊÓÆµâ€™s Gordon Bush Airport is home to Francis Fuller Training Center, where almost 120 Russ College of Engineering and Technology students are working toward their private and commercial pilot licenses. The College also offers an aviation management degree. Future pilots start in the classroom and can eventually become Certified Flight Instructors themselves, along the way banking more than 1,400 hours in flight before receiving their degrees.

Start Small

"Little Otter Learns to Swim," authored by Artie Knapp, AIS ’04, and illustrated by Guy Hobbs, teaches children the value of persistence in overcoming fears and challenges when acquiring new skills, using North American river otters as inspiration. The book, published by ºÚÁÏÊÓÆµ Press, also pays tribute to the species and incorporates conservation messages contributed by the River Otter Ecology Project.
